No BS summary

Nivoda seeks a VP of Growth to build the marketing function from scratch, owning strategy, growth model, budget, team, and revenue number, reporting directly to the President and sitting on the senior leadership team. The role focuses on scaling a two-sided B2B marketplace for the global jewellery industry with data-driven experimentation and a remote-first culture.

What you'll do

  • Owning Nivoda's marketing strategy end to end - translating company goals into a growth model, then into channels, programmes and headcount that deliver it
  • Building the marketing team: hiring, structuring, levelling up, and building systems, briefs and feedback loops
  • Owning demand generation and pipeline contribution for both sides of the marketplace
  • Building the measurement layer: attribution, funnel instrumentation, CAC and payback by segment and geography, and a reporting rhythm leadership trusts
  • Running marketing as a portfolio of experiments: defining leading indicators, killing failures quickly, and doubling down on wins
  • Owning positioning and product marketing across a multi-product platform
  • Building the category narrative for the operating system for the jewellery industry
  • Driving lifecycle and retention marketing with product teams for onboarding, activation, and share-of-wallet growth
  • Partnering with Sales and Revenue leadership on segmentation and sales enablement
  • Localizing go-to-market across the US, UK, India, Europe, and Asia
  • Owning the marketing budget and defending ROI
  • Representing marketing at leadership and board level

What they require

  • Significant experience leading marketing in B2B SMB - selling to owner-operators and small businesses
  • Track record of building marketing teams and functions from the ground up
  • Deep, hands-on data and growth orientation - you build growth models, run experiments with statistical discipline, and can talk about CAC, payback, and cohort behaviour
  • Demonstrated ownership of a pipeline or revenue number, with receipts
  • Profit position: you've owned some combination of performance, content, product marketing, lifecycle, and brand, and know which matter now versus later
  • Genuine senior leadership: you've hired, managed managers, made hard calls, and held your own with a founder, CEO or board
  • The judgment to say no - you can name channels you deliberately didn't pursue and explain why
  • Comfort with ambiguity and low hierarchy: you can write ad copy and present a three-year growth model
  • Excellent written and spoken English, and ability to operate across time zones
